Characterization of a β-lactamase that contributes to intrinsic β-lactam resistance in <i>Clostridioides difficile</i>
2019-05-07
Abstract excerpt
<h4>ABSTRACT</h4> Clostrididioides difficile causes severe antibiotic-associated diarrhea and colitis. C. difficile is an anaerobic, Gram-positive spore former that is highly resistant to β-lactams, the most commonly prescribed antibiotics.
